Pharmexcil to Showcase India Pavilion at World Health Expo 2026 in Dubai

The Pharmaceuticals Export Promotion Council of India (Pharmexcil) will host the India Pavilion at the World Health Expo (WHX) 2026, to be held from February 9 to 12, 2026, at the Dubai Exhibition Centre, UAE. Covering 522 square meters and featuring 61 exhibition stalls, the India Pavilion will highlight India’s growing leadership in pharmaceuticals, biotechnology, and healthcare innovation.

This marks Pharmexcil’s 19th consecutive participation in the prestigious Dubai health exhibition, formerly known as Arab Health. The Council is inviting Indian pharma exporters and healthcare manufacturers to participate in this influential international platform, especially those targeting growth in the Middle East and African markets.

World Health Expo 2026: A Global Healthcare Powerhouse

The World Health Expo (WHX) Dubai 2026 is one of the largest global healthcare trade shows, bringing together over 4,800 exhibitors and more than 270,000 visitors from 180+ countries. The event connects healthcare professionals, innovators, doctors, investors, and policymakers, offering a powerful space for networking, knowledge sharing, and B2B partnerships.

This edition of WHX introduces a new venue and expanded format, co-located with WHX Labs Dubai (formerly Medlab Middle East), creating the world’s largest integrated healthcare and medical technology exhibition.

The central theme, “Shaping the Future of Healthcare,” will spotlight sustainable innovations, AI-driven medical solutions, and next-generation healthcare technologies redefining the global industry.

Supported by the Ministry of Commerce and Industry, Government of India, Pharmexcil is offering subsidized stalls within the India Pavilion, significantly below standard organizer rates. Companies can reserve stalls online through Pharmexcil’s official booking portal.

“We are offering India Pavilion stalls at concessional rates thanks to government support,” said Raja Bhanu, Director General, Pharmexcil. “Members are also eligible for travel reimbursement under the Market Access Initiative (MAI) Scheme), in line with the latest government guidelines and fund releases.”

Eligibility for Participation

Pharmexcil has set clear eligibility guidelines to ensure fair participation:

  • The exhibitor must be a registered Pharmexcil member for at least one year.
  • The company’s export turnover during the previous financial year must be ₹50 crore or less.
  • The exhibitor should not have participated through the India Pavilion in Arab Health/WHX for more than three years previously.

World-Class Pavilion Design

The India Pavilion will be designed to international exhibition standards, eliminating the need for individual stall setups. However, exhibitors may use customized stall designs (within height and branding limits) after Pharmexcil’s prior approval.

Each participant can reserve up to two adjacent stalls, with a maximum limit of 18 square meters per company. Bookings require 100% payment within 10 days of reservation, and all payments must be completed by November 17, 2025, to confirm participation.

Promoting India’s Global Pharma Strength

Through the India Pavilion at World Health Expo 2026, Pharmexcil aims to project India’s pharmaceutical excellence, foster international trade collaborations, and enhance brand India’s visibility in the global healthcare market.

The participation aligns with India’s vision of becoming a world hub for affordable, high-quality medicines and medical technology, strengthening its presence across emerging healthcare economies.
